Peterborough United vs Reading: form, goals and key statistics

Key match information

Peterborough United played Reading in EFL League One (England). The match was played on 29 December 2025. Final score: 1:1.

Current form

Peterborough United: 4-0-1, 2.40 points/match. Reading: 3-0-2, 1.80 points/match.

Goal statistics

Peterborough United scores 1.19 and concedes 1.29 goals per match. Reading scores 1.33 and concedes 1.29. League average: 2.55 goals.
